#include <stdio.h>
#include <stdlib.h>
#define QueueSize 10
typedef struct
{
char data [QueueSize];
int front,rear;
}SqQueue;
void InitQueue(SqQueue &qu) //初始化队列
{
qu.rear=qu.front=0;
}
int EnQueue(SqQueue &qu, char x) //进队
{
if((qu.rear+1)%QueueSize==qu.front)
return 0;
else
{
qu.rear=(qu.rear+1)%QueueSize;
qu.data[qu.rear]=x;
return 1;
}
}
int DeQueue(SqQueue &qu,char &x) //出队
{
if(qu.rear==qu.front)
return 0;
else
{
qu.front=(qu.front+1)%QueueSize;
x=qu.data[qu.front];
return 1;
}
}
int GetHead(SqQueue qu,char x) //取队头元素
{
if(qu.rear=qu.front)
return 0;
else
{
x=qu.data[(qu.front+1)%QueueSize];
return 1;
}
}
int QueuEmpty(SqQueue qu) //判断队空
{
if(qu.front==qu.rear)
return 1;
else
return 0;
}
